Wintry Precipitation Mix Possible In The CSRA Monday Night

A strong arctic high pressure system which has affected the CSRA the last two days will gradually shift east of the area...allowing for a return of moisture to the CSRA late Monday night. This will result in precipitation moving into the western portions of the CSRA after midnight and the remainder of the area through Tuesday morning.

Enough cold air is expected to be in place to result in a 3 to 6 hour period of light snow or light snow mixed with freezing rain and rain to the north and mainly rain to the south.

All the precipitation will turn to rain by Tuesday afternoon.
